Dmitry Gutov <dgutov <at> yandex.ru> writes:

> Hovering the mouse over the mode-line does trigger the necessary
> redisplay. Alt-Tabbing to another window and then back also does
> that. Is that relevant?
>
> Simply moving the mouse (not over the mode-line) doesn't help.
>
> The refresh can also happen on its own, in 1-2 seconds.

I think this isn't a problem with the GLib input code then.

Alt-tabbing makes the X event reading code explicitly ask for a
redisplay.  If you build --with-checking=yes,glyphs and call
`trace-redisplay', what happens when the redisplay does not happen?
